21xrx.com
2024-11-25 03:08:53 Monday
登录
文章检索 我的文章 写文章
C++调试技巧:如何快速查错?
2023-07-05 10:38:30 深夜i     --     --
C++ 调试 快速查错 技巧

在编写C++程序时,调试是一个非常重要的过程。在C++编程中,经常会遇到bug和错误,这些错误可能会导致程序崩溃或产生错误结果,影响程序的性能和稳定性。因此,了解C++调试的技巧和技能是非常必要的。

以下是一些C++调试技巧,可以帮助您更快地查找错误:

1. 使用断言:断言是一种在程序执行中检查条件的方法。C++提供了"assert"宏,通过在程序中插入这些宏可以检查代码中的错误和bug。如果条件不成立,程序将会崩溃并输出错误信息,从而帮助您更快地定位问题所在。

2. 输出调试信息:在编写C++程序时,使用输出调试信息也是非常重要的。使用cout输出变量或状态信息,可以帮助您追踪代码执行的过程,并找出问题所在。在调用的函数中加入输出信息,可以帮助您查看函数的输入和输出,以便更好地理解程序的执行过程。

3. 使用调试器:调试器是一种可以帮助您查找错误的重要工具。调试器可以让您暂停程序的执行,并逐步调试程序,查看变量的值和程序的执行流程。通过使用调试器,可以更快地查找并定位错误所在。

4. 使用日志:在C++编程中,使用日志也是一种非常有效的调试技巧。可以在程序中插入日志函数,在程序中记录变量信息和程序执行的过程,从而帮助您更好地理解程序的执行过程。

在调试C++程序时,需要耐心和仔细。处理错误需要花费时间和精力,但是不要放弃,要坚持调试下去,直到找到问题所在。使用上述的C++调试技巧,可以帮助您更快地查找并解决C++程序中的错误和bug。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复